What is CVE-2026-14559?
The Teddy Bear Customize Addon for WordPress, up to version 1.0.5, contains a significant vulnerability as it fails to verify users' passwords before authentication. This flaw enables attackers to gain unauthorized access by simply entering the email address of any registered user, potentially compromising accounts at all levels, including those of administrators. Proper authentication checks are necessary to prevent such vulnerabilities and ensure user account security.
Affected Version(s)
teddy-bear-customize-addon 0 <= 1.0.5
